The Sr. Manager, Channel Sales will be leading our Channel Sales North America team and is responsible for shaping and driving the company’s partner‑led revenue strategy across the U.S. and Canada. This role blends strategic leadership, partner ecosystem development, and revenue accountability. This team oversees all aspects of partner‑driven sales in North America, ensuring that the Lytx platform(s) are effectively positioned and supported through the partner channel. This includes setting the channel strategy, managing partner relationships, and leading a team that executes on revenue goals.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ute the North American channel strategy: Define the partner ecosystem, segmentation, and growth priorities; evolve the strategy as markets shift.
  • Drive revenue and accurate forecasting through channel partners: Own partner‑sourced and partner‑influenced revenue targets; ensure predictable pipeline and forecasting.
  • Build and strengthen partner relationships: Recruit, onboard, and enable partners; deepen collaboration with top-tier partners to unlock market potential.
  • Lead and develop the channel sales team: Manage channel sales managers by setting appropriate goals and coaching performance.
  • Collaborate cross‑functionally: Work closely with marketing, product, sales engineering, and operations to support partner success.
  • Optimize partner programs: Improve incentives, MDF usage, enablement frameworks, and partner certifications.
  • Monitor market trends and competitive dynamics: Adjust strategy based on technology shifts, customer needs, and competitor moves.
  • Represent the channel internally and externally: Advocate for partner needs and represent the company at industry and partner events.

Industry-leading fleet and compliance management solutions. At Lytx®, we harness the power of video and data to enable fleets to improve safety, efficiency, and productivity. We’re trusted by more than 5,500 organizations that log billions of miles worldwide each year, contributing to a vast and ever-growing database of driving data we use to refine the accuracy and effectiveness of our solutions. Our clients can realize significant returns on investment by lowering operating and insurance costs. Most of all, we strive to save lives—on our roads and in our communities, every day. We dream of a world where no commercial driver is ever the cause of a collision.

We’re driven by a passion to improve safety on our roadways. Our solutions enhance vehicles with a suite of cloud-connected dash cams, sensors, telematics, and services that help transform fleet safety and operations.
